I thought I would check in with you all. It has been a few months since I decided to explore the trumpet and give up steel guitar. I finally sold my last lap steel and while I still have my dobros, they are gathering dust (I'd give someone a good deal to take at least one of them off my hands). I've stopped going to gigs where I used to play the Dobro.

The fact is, after denying it for so long, the trumpet really took over. Yesterday I bought a flugelhorn and spent hours playing it. I come home excited to practice and recently have made some huge strides in endurance, range, and tone. I'm playing jazz, my first love, on a brass instrument instead of my trying to retrofit jazz playing on a steel instrument which I couldn't ever really get to work.

I would say for all you comeback players like me, it is never too late to go with your original passion. I made lots of friends here and in the community through my steel playing. But playing jazz on a brass instrument is like coming home after a long prison sentence. Everything about it is wonderful and I love practicing every second I can.
